The tantalizing scent of garlic butter wafts through my kitchen, instantly lifting my spirits. I can’t help but smile at the sight of juicy meatballs sizzling in their buttery bath, a perfect harbinger of comfort food on a busy evening. Today, I’m excited to share my recipe for Garlic Butter Meatballs with Parmesan Linguine, a delightful twist on classic Italian-American cuisine. Not only is this dish quick to prepare, making it perfect for a weeknight dinner, but it’s also a crowd-pleaser that transforms any gathering into a festive occasion. Imagine cozying up to a bowl of rich, creamy pasta enveloped in savory meatballs that will warm your heart and soul. Curious about how to create this comforting masterpiece in your own kitchen? Let’s dive in!

Why Are Garlic Butter Meatballs Irresistible?
Perfection, this recipe combines the delectable flavors of garlic butter with tender, juicy meatballs, delivering an unforgettable dish that will linger in your memory. Ease, with simple ingredients and straightforward steps, it’s perfect for home cooks at any skill level. Versatility, pair these meatballs with creamy Parmesan linguine or get creative with options such as spiralized zucchini. Crowd-Pleaser, it’s a surefire hit at family dinners and gatherings, leaving everyone asking for seconds. Flavor, the rich garlic butter sauce and robust seasonings create a comfort food experience that beats any takeout. Enjoy with a side of sautéed spinach or a crisp salad for a complete meal!
Garlic Butter Meatballs Ingredients
• To create delightful Garlic Butter Meatballs, gather these essential ingredients for a meal your family will love!
For the Meatballs
- Ground Beef (or Beef + Pork) – This is the main protein; using a mix enhances flavor and moistness.
- Egg – Acts as a binder to hold the meatballs together for a perfect texture.
- Breadcrumbs – Helps retain moisture and adds structure, ensuring juicy meatballs.
- Grated Parmesan Cheese – Enhances flavor; you can substitute with Pecorino for a different twist.
- Chopped Parsley – Adds freshness and a bright pop of color to your dish.
- Minced Garlic – Infuses savory depth to both the meatballs and the sauce; a must for flavor.
- Salt & Black Pepper – Basic seasonings that elevate the overall taste of the meatballs.
For the Sauce
- Olive Oil – Used for searing the meatballs; extra virgin olive oil brings exceptional flavor.
- Unsalted Butter – Forms the base of your beautiful Garlic Butter sauce; adjust if using salted butter.
- Red Pepper Flakes – Optional for a kick of heat that balances the richness of the dish.
- Lemon Juice – Brightens up the sauce and adds a refreshing touch to the flavors.
- Heavy Cream – Creates a luscious and creamy pasta sauce, perfect for comforting meals.
For the Pasta
- Linguine – The ideal pasta for soaking up the sauce; swap with spaghetti or gluten-free pasta if needed.
- Pasta Water – Helps adjust the sauce consistency, ensuring it clings beautifully to the pasta.
Now that you have all the ingredients gathered, it’s time to bring this Garlic Butter Meatballs recipe to life! Enjoy the cooking process and the mouthwatering results!
Step‑by‑Step Instructions for Garlic Butter Meatballs
Step 1: Make the Meatballs
In a large mixing bowl, combine the ground beef, egg, breadcrumbs, grated Parmesan cheese, chopped parsley, minced garlic, salt, and black pepper. Mix gently until just combined—overmixing can lead to tough meatballs. Form the mixture into 1-inch balls, aiming for 20-24 total. Set these beautiful meatballs aside while you prepare to sear them.
Step 2: Sear the Meatballs
Heat a couple of tablespoons of olive oil in a large skillet over medium heat. Once hot, add the meatballs to the skillet, ensuring not to overcrowd them. Brown the meatballs on all sides, which will take about 6-8 minutes. They should be golden and slightly crispy. Once done, remove the meatballs from the skillet and set them aside; we’ll come back to them shortly.
Step 3: Cook the Garlic Butter Sauce
In the same skillet, reduce the heat to low to keep the residual oil warm. Add the unsalted butter, allowing it to melt completely. Toss in the minced garlic and optional red pepper flakes, cooking for 1-2 minutes until fragrant—be careful not to let the garlic brown. Squeeze in fresh lemon juice, then return the seared meatballs to the sauce, simmering them for 5-7 minutes so they absorb all the delicious garlic butter flavor.
Step 4: Make the Pasta
Fill a large pot with salted water and bring it to a boil. Cook the linguine according to the package directions until al dente, checking around 8–10 minutes. Once cooked, reserve ½ cup of pasta water before draining the linguine. In a separate pan, melt additional butter, then add heavy cream and let it simmer, stirring until it’s warmed through. Gradually mix in Parmesan cheese until melted, creating a rich sauce.
Step 5: Combine Meatballs and Pasta
Toss the cooked linguine into the creamy sauce, mixing well to coat each noodle evenly. If the sauce is too thick, slowly incorporate the reserved pasta water until you reach your desired consistency. Delicately add the meatballs from the garlic butter sauce to the pasta, ensuring each meatball is lovingly enveloped in the creamy goodness.
Step 6: Plate and Serve
To serve your mouthwatering Garlic Butter Meatballs, plate the linguine in generous portions. Layer the golden meatballs atop the pasta and generously drizzle with the savory garlic butter sauce from the skillet. Garnish with additional chopped parsley and more grated Parmesan for that extra touch. Your delightful meal is ready to be enjoyed!

What to Serve with Garlic Butter Meatballs?
To create a complete dining experience that celebrates the richness of your meal, consider these delightful accompaniments.
- Simple Green Salad: A fresh garden salad with crisp greens and a light vinaigrette adds brightness, balancing the richness of the meatballs and creamy pasta.
- Garlic Bread: Soft, buttery garlic bread acts as the perfect vehicle for mopping up any leftover garlic butter sauce, making every bite irresistible.
- Sautéed Spinach: This vibrant side dish introduces a luscious green element, offering a nutritious contrast while complementing the flavors of the garlic butter.
- Roasted Broccoli: Crisp-tender broccoli tossed with olive oil and seasoning contrasts beautifully with the creamy pasta, adding both nutrition and texture.
- Chilled White Wine: A crisp Sauvignon Blanc or Pinot Grigio pairs beautifully with the buttery notes of the dish, enhancing the overall flavor experience.
- Sparkling Water with Lemon: Refreshing sparkling water with a splash of lemon brightens the palate, making each bite of your meal even more enjoyable.
- Chocolate Mousse: End your dinner with a rich, velvety chocolate mousse that provides a delightful sweet surprise after the savory feast—pure comfort for your sweet tooth!
Garlic Butter Meatballs Variations
Feel free to lighten up or spice up this recipe with these exciting options that will add a personal touch!
-
Ground Turkey: Opt for ground turkey instead of beef for a leaner meatball option that still delivers on flavor. Your family won’t even notice the difference!
-
Low-Carb Delight: Swap out the linguine for spiralized zucchini or cauliflower puree to keep things low-carb and still delicious. This way, you enjoy the rich garlic butter sauce in a lighter form.
-
Spice It Up: If you love a kick, add an extra dash of red pepper flakes or cayenne pepper for a spicier twist. Elevate your meal’s flavor profile to suit your heat preference!
-
Dairy-Free Version: Omit the heavy cream and use olive oil combined with reserved pasta water to create a lighter, dairy-free sauce that retains the indulgence of garlic butter.
-
Flavorful Infusions: Incorporate herbs like basil or oregano into your meatball mixture for an herbal freshness that elevates the taste even further. It’s a great way to switch up the flavor profiles!
-
Cheesy Variations: Experiment with different cheeses, like Pecorino or aged Gouda, for a unique flavor twist in your meatballs or sauce. It’s a delightful exploration of cheese love!
-
Sauce Substitutions: For a different sauce experience, consider adding a splash of marinara sauce to the garlic butter for an Italian touch that’s bound to impress!
-
Pasta Options: Switch out linguine for spaghetti, penne, or even gluten-free pasta to cater to different dietary needs while enjoying the same great flavors.
Whether you try these variations or stick to the classic, you’re sure to create a memorable meal. For those looking for alternative recipes, you may enjoy checking out [Garlic Butter Honey](https://simplerecipesandcookingtips.com/garlic-butter-honey-bbq-beef-tacos/) or [Garlic Butter Steak](https://simplerecipesandcookingtips.com/garlic-butter-steak-bites-with-creamy-mashed-potatoes-recipe/). Enjoy the warmth of homemade comfort food!
Expert Tips for Garlic Butter Meatballs
-
Gentle Mixing: Avoid overworking the meat mixture to keep your garlic butter meatballs light and tender. Mix just until combined.
-
Careful Browning: Watch the meatballs closely while searing to prevent burning. They should be golden-brown and slightly crispy for the best flavor.
-
Pasta Water Magic: Reserve enough pasta water to adjust the sauce’s texture. Adding it gradually helps ensure a perfect coating on your pasta.
-
Baking Alternative: For a healthier option, form the meatballs and bake at 400°F (200°C) for 15–18 minutes instead of searing.
-
Custom Flavor: Feel free to add more red pepper flakes for extra heat or adjust the lemon juice according to your taste preferences.
Make Ahead Options
These Garlic Butter Meatballs are perfect for meal prep enthusiasts! You can prepare the meatballs up to 24 hours in advance by mixing the ingredients and forming them into balls, then refrigerate them in an airtight container. Similarly, you can cook the pasta a day ahead; simply toss it with a little olive oil to prevent sticking. When you’re ready to serve, just sear the meatballs and simmer them in the garlic butter sauce, then combine with the pasta. This way, you spend less time cooking during the week while still enjoying restaurant-quality Garlic Butter Meatballs with Parmesan Linguine that are just as delicious as if freshly made!
How to Store and Freeze Garlic Butter Meatballs
- Fridge: Store leftover garlic butter meatballs in an airtight container for up to 4 days. This keeps them fresh and ready for a quick meal.
- Freezer: Freeze cooked meatballs (without pasta) for up to 3 months. Place them in a single layer on a baking sheet until firm, then transfer to a freezer bag for longer shelf life.
- Reheating: To reheat, place meatballs in a skillet or microwave. If using the skillet, add a splash of water or broth to maintain moisture while warming.
- Meal Prep: For meal prep, assemble meatballs and sauce ahead of time, refrigerating them separately to keep flavors fresh; combine before serving.

Garlic Butter Meatballs Recipe FAQs
How can I choose the best ground meat for my meatballs?
Absolutely! For the most flavorful garlic butter meatballs, I recommend using a combination of ground beef and pork. The beef adds heartiness, while the pork enhances moisture and tenderness. Look for ground meats that have a bit of fat, around 15-20%, to keep your meatballs juicy. If you’re looking for a leaner option, ground turkey is a great alternative, but be cautious, as it can dry out more easily.
What’s the best way to store leftover garlic butter meatballs?
After you’ve enjoyed your delicious meal, store any leftovers in an airtight container in the fridge. They should stay fresh for up to 4 days. Just reheat them in a skillet with a splash of broth to keep them juicy and flavorful. If you pack them carefully, they’re perfect as a quick lunch or dinner!
Can I freeze garlic butter meatballs? If so, how?
Very much so! You can freeze your cooked meatballs for up to 3 months. To do this, lay them out in a single layer on a baking sheet and place them in the freezer until firm—about 1-2 hours. Once frozen, transfer the meatballs to a freezer-safe bag or container. This method prevents them from sticking together, making it easy to grab just what you need later!
What should I do if my meatballs are too dry?
If you find your garlic butter meatballs turning out dry, there are a few tricks to avoid this in the future. First, ensure you mix the meat mixture just until combined—overmixing can lead to dense meatballs. Additionally, incorporating ingredients like soaked breadcrumbs or even a splash of milk helps maintain moisture. If they end up dry post-cooking, adding them to a sauce for a few minutes can help salvage their texture.
Are garlic butter meatballs safe for my family if someone has allergies?
Absolutely! However, it’s essential to check individual ingredient labels to avoid any allergens. For example, if someone is allergic to dairy, you can omit the Parmesan cheese or use a dairy-free alternative. Also, be mindful of bread if gluten is a concern; gluten-free breadcrumbs can be a great substitute. Always make adjustments according to your family’s dietary needs for safe and delicious enjoyment!

Garlic Butter Meatballs: Comfort Food Your Family Will Love
Ingredients
Equipment
Method
- In a large mixing bowl, combine the ground beef, egg, breadcrumbs, grated Parmesan cheese, chopped parsley, minced garlic, salt, and black pepper. Mix gently until just combined. Form into 1-inch meatballs (20-24 total).
- Heat olive oil in a large skillet over medium heat. Add the meatballs, browning on all sides (6-8 minutes). Remove meatballs from skillet.
- In the same skillet, reduce heat to low. Add unsalted butter and let it melt, then add minced garlic and red pepper flakes, cooking for 1-2 minutes. Add lemon juice and return meatballs to the skillet, simmering for 5-7 minutes.
- Boil salted water in a large pot, and cook linguine until al dente (8-10 minutes). Reserve 1/2 cup of pasta water before draining.
- In a separate pan, melt additional butter, then add heavy cream. Mix in Parmesan until melted, creating a sauce.
- Toss linguine with sauce, then add meatballs, ensuring each is covered in the sauce. Adjust thickness with reserved pasta water if necessary.
- Serve by plating linguine topped with meatballs and drizzled with sauce. Garnish with parsley and extra Parmesan.

Leave a Reply